Man dies in Montgomery shooting
The victim in a Tuesday shooting in Montgomery has died.
Montgomery police say around 9:33 p.m., officers responded to a local hospital in reference to a person shot.
Once there, they located 22-year-old Tyler Cleveland, of Montgomery, with a life-threatening gunshot wound.
Cleveland later died from his injuries Wednesday.
It was later determined that it happened in the 2100 block of Mona Lisa Drive.
